    I quit LoL a while back, so maybe they fixed this issue, but there is/was a fundamental difference to climbing in master, GM, and challenger then there is to climbing in iron through diamond. One has divisions and promos that will reset your LP, and the other doesn't. In master if you can keep a 52% win rate on your climb, you will increase your LP long term. If you can maintain 52% win rate over 1500 games with on average 16 lp gain/loss a game you will end up with around 960 more lp then you started with. The minimum LP to enter grand master is 200 and challenger is 500 to put this into perception. Below Masters, promotional and divisional games are/were things and dropping rank was/is east The problem with 52% win rate is it is extremely hard to reliably win the 3/4 games needed to advance a division or the 4/6 needed to promote. In addition when you failed to advance your lp would reset to a benchmark. You start a new division 0 lp. Lose 2 games and your back to your previous LP, but not at 100 LP, but at a predefined 60 lp. This means in order to advance a division you didn't just need a 52% win rate. You also needed a properly timed set of roughly 8 games where you only lost 2 times. If you lost more then that you would fall back to the previous/current division 60 lp. The chance of winning 6 out of 8 games at 52% win rate is: C(8,2).52^6.48^2 ~ 12.75%. So every division takes roughly 8 attempts to climb past (at 8 games each). This is in addition to getting to the point to climb. assuming 16 lp a game again. It takes 64 games to gain 30 lp and 110 games to get to the point in the process where you are oscillating between divisions (the other 70 lp).This means to gain a full 100 lp with a 52% win rate, it takes on average 175 games. If you played 1500 games like the master player you would go up roughly 8 divisions. If your goal was to go from bronze to gold you would probably need to play more then double the games a player would need to to go from masters to high challeneger, at the same win rate. The way to climb in below master is/was not with a 52% win rate. It is/was by getting better at winning games then everyone else your playing against/with. Not sure if LoL ever got better.     Very similar experiences for tristana on bot vs mid based off what I'm hearing except you have several things that make her harder to perform. You're in a 2v2 on bot, so your lane is dictated differently and "war of attrition" is not always necessarily a playable option. Your passive is a downside in unfavorable 2v2's because it forces you to forever push. You're against 2 champs, not 1, so your goal is to set up for support plays and hope they perform well and be ready for kill opportunities especially at lvls 2-3 and 6 when they decide they can move. If you don't get a kill by lvl 2-3 on tristana on bot, your game is going to be incredibly more difficult and you're hoping to play on a random jungle or dragon skirmish with wave prio in order to create some kind of lead, or for a bot lane dive by the jungler or a roaming mid for an advantage. You can't take demolish as a bot laner, so tower plate destroying is only a "sometimes" option as well, and then as you enter the mid game you might want to split in the same style in some moments, but now you have to do so while down 2 levels compared to everyone else, so you get less opportunities than you would had you just played her mid, plus again, you don't have demolish so its not as good as just dueling it out in a fight. It's much more emphasized on playing fights well for bot lane than macro plays. Basically tristana mid is easy mode while tristana bot is hard mode. She seems like such a better mid laner to me.

    On the topic of streaking: What got left out here is the high likelyhood of just random streaks of the same result. Even a perfectly random coin will most likely have a 6 to 7 turn tails streak as its longest streak when thrown 100 times. Randomly getting 5 bad games in a row is much more likely than people seem to assume.
